Claude Code version 2.1.120 crashed on startup when users attempted to resume prior sessions using the --resume or --continue flags, affecting claude.ai, console.anthropic.com, and api.anthropic.com. Users experienced pages that wouldn't load fully and spinning interfaces when entering prompts. The issue was resolved after 48 minutes by automatically rolling back affected clients to version 2.1.119.
This incident has been resolved.
We have identified an issue in Claude Code version 2.1.120 that causes a crash when resuming a prior session via the --resume or --continue flags. Auto-update will move affected clients back to 2.1.119 on next check, but you can always run `claude install 2.1.119`.
